Output 77528e9578bf915a9b048128dff34e300c0a85d9b9c9a27f287667a7bff664bd:1

value
9023294
script pubkey
OP_0 OP_PUSHBYTES_20 cdc86186e2255ca8636daae2d66dfdf3b646dc3d
address
bc1qehyxrphzy4w2scmd4t3dvm0a7wmydhpa7w0snc
transaction
77528e9578bf915a9b048128dff34e300c0a85d9b9c9a27f287667a7bff664bd
spent
true